Saints Perpetua and Felicity: Third Century Martyrs

WebPerpetua and Felicity (died 7 March 203) are Christian martyrs of the 3rd century. Perpetua (born in 181) was a 22-year old married noble, and a nursing mother. Her co-martyr Felicity, an expectant mother, was her slave. They suffered together at Carthage in the Roman province of Africa. WebThere Perpetua and Felicity were beheaded, and the others killed by beasts. Felicity gave birth to a daughter a few days before the games commenced. WebMar 7, 2024 · Vibia Perpetua was recently married noblewoman of Carthage and new mother. In 202 AD she and a slave (and new mother) named Felicity, along with three men, Revocatus, Saturninus, and Secudulus were arrested and imprisoned for being new converts to Christianity.
